1945‑04‑06 | 305 | 930 | Target: Railroad Marshalling Yards (Visual Primary) Type: Transportation Location: Leipzig, Germany |
Leipzig Railyard Bombed: The 384th Bombardment Group (H) flew as the 41st Combat Bombardment Wing A Group. Due to 10/10ths cloud cover over the primary (visual) target aim point, bombs were released at the secondary (PFF) aim point. |
